TikTok upgrades guidelines, releases Urdu version

Pakistan Press Foundation

ISLAMABAD: After warnings and negotiations with the telecom regulator, global short funny video platform TikTok has not only upgraded its ‘Community Guidelines’, but also released its Urdu language version for the first time. SC chides police over report in journalist kidnap case
